Albert Adomah registers assist in Aston Villa stalemate with Brentford FC

Albert Adomah Kodjia Albert Adomah joins his teammate to celebrate the goal

Thu, 23 Aug 2018 Source: ghanasoccernet.com

Ghana forward Albert Adomah provided an assist as Aston Villa rallied back to play 2-2 draw with Brentford in the English Championship on Wednesday evening.

Villa, who have started the season in fantastic form, having picked seven points from three games.

Steve Bruce's were hoping to continue their superb home form when Brentford visited the Villa Park.

However, it was the visitors who fetched the opener in the 23rd minute through French forward Neal Maupay but Jonathan Kodjia leveled the scores for the hosts in the 39th minute with a fine finish after connecting beautifully to Albert Adomah's sleek pass.

Aston Villa were pegged back again courtesy Neal Maupay's 82nd minute strike but Villa rallied back to snatch a draw following Jonathan Kodjia's last-gasp equalizer.

Adomah lasted 70 minutes as he was replaced with Andre Green.

He has been left out of the Black Stars 18-man squad for next month's 2019 African Cup of Nations qualifier against the Harambee Stars of Kenya despite his fine start to the campaign.
